Pothole Repair Underway On Montgomery Co. Highways

Winter weather has wreaked havoc on 422, Route 100, and other major roads around Montgomery County.

MONTGOMERY COUNTY, PA — With winter weather and fluctuating temperatures wreaking havoc on Philadelphia area roads, PennDOT crews will take to the region's highways this week to make repairs.

A total of more than 40 state highways will see special treatment from crews.

The following locations in Montgomery County will be repaired, according to PennDOT:

  • U.S. 202 and associated ramps in Upper Merion Township and Bridgeport Borough
  • U.S. 422 and associated ramps in Upper Merion, Lower Pottsgrove, Limerick, Upper Providence, and Lower Providence townships
  • Route 100 in Pottstown Borough, Upper Pottsgrove and Douglas townships

Travel will be restricted in areas that are being repaved, and motorists may experience minor delays in some cases.
